Reciting the tasbeeh once in ruku and sajda

Answered as per Hanafi Fiqh by Muftionline.co.za

Q: Is it acceptable if I recite subhaana rabbial azeem in Ruku and subhaana rabbial a’la in sujud one time only instead of three times in the case when there is limited time available. For example I am performing Sunnah Salaah and Jamat has started or Qadha time is near etc.

Bismillaah

A: The Salaah will be valid. However it is better to read it at least thrice in order to conform to the Sunnah.

And Allah Ta’ala (الله تعالى) knows best.

و يقول في ​كوعه سبحان ربّي العظيم ثلاثا و ذلك أدناه (الفتاوى الهندية 1/74)

وصرحوا بأنه يكره أن ينقص عن الثلاث وأن الزيادة مستحبة بعد أن يختم على وتر خمس أو سبع ما لم يكن إماما فلا يطول (رد المحتار 1/494)
